什么是以太坊钱包地址
以太坊是一个去中心化的开放源代码区块链平台,其上可以构建智能合约和去中心化应用(dApps)。在进行交易时,用户需要使用以太坊钱包地址来接收和发送以太币(ETH)以及在以太坊网络上的其他代币。
以太坊钱包地址是一串长度为42个字符的字符串,通常以“0x”开头,后面跟随40个十六进制字符(即0-9和a-f的组合)。这些地址用来唯一标识每一个钱包,并且在区块链上是公开的,任何人都可以查询到与该地址相关的交易记录。
以太坊地址的开头字符解析
以太坊所有的地址均以“0x”开头,这不仅是用于标识它们属于以太坊网络的一个编码约定,也表示后面的字符是以十六进制形式呈现。因此,如果你看到一个以“0x”开头的钱包地址,你可以确信它是以太坊网络上的有效地址。
除了“0x”这个前缀,后面的40个字符组合由用户生成的公钥得出,与私钥密切相关。公钥和私钥是密切相关的,它们的结合确保了地址的安全性。因此,掌握这一点是非常关键的,尤其是在数字资产交易中。
以太坊地址的结构
以太坊地址通常是固定格式的。完整的以太坊地址是:
- 长度:42个字符(包括0x开头的2个字符)
- 格式:0x 40个十六进制字符
对于开发者和技术爱好者来说,了解这些基本结构有助于深入研究以太坊网络的工作原理。以太坊地址不仅承载着资金的去向,还对应着执行的合约、存储的数据等重要信息。
以太坊钱包地址的生成
生成一个以太坊钱包地址的过程其实相对复杂,涉及多种密码学原理。普通用户通常使用钱包软件来生成地址,但理解其背后的原理是非常有价值的。
首先,生成钱包的步骤如下:
- 从一个随机数(种子)生成私钥。私钥是一个随机生成的256位数。
- 通过特定算法(如椭圆曲线加密算法)从私钥生成公钥。
- 根据公钥生成以太坊地址,通过Keccak-256哈希算法,最后得到地址。这个地址通常是公钥的哈希值。
这一切都是为了确保钱包的安全性和唯一性,任何钱包地址都是无法从其他地址推导出来的,确保用户的资产安全。
以太坊地址的安全性
不同于传统的银行账户,区块链钱包地址的安全性完全由用户自己控制。只有拥有相应私钥的人才能进行交易。而丢失私钥将导致钱包中所有资产的不可找回。因此,用户应妥善保管好自己的私钥。此外,采用硬件钱包、冷钱包等安全措施尤为重要。
另外,已存在一些以太坊地址的白名单和黑名单机制,一些平台为了防止诈骗和盗窃,和用户之间进行交流时,会推荐用户确认地址的合法性。此外,在交易过程中,用户也应该小心防范钓鱼网站,不轻信来历不明的链接,以保障自己资产的安全。
如何有效管理以太坊钱包地址
管理以太坊钱包地址不仅涉及到资金安全,还包括简化用户体验和便捷的资产查看。对于频繁进行数字资产交易的用户来说,管理多个以太坊钱包可能变得相当复杂。
以下是一些有效的管理建议:
- 使用分类管理工具:可以使用具有多币种支持的数字货币钱包工具,便于用户管理不同的资产。
- 频繁备份:定期备份私钥或助记词,以防丢失造成损失。
- 监控地址:利用区块链浏览器监控自己的地址交易情况,方便管理和及时调整投资策略。
- 养成安全习惯:定期更改使用的钱包地址,为每次交易选择新的地址,增加安全性。
总结
以太坊钱包地址以“0x”开头,后面跟随40个十六进制字符,是Ethereum网络中标识用户身份和资产的基础。了解以太坊地址的结构及其安全性,对于每一个希望参与到区块链世界中的人都至关重要。通过有效的管理和保护措施,用户可以最大限度地保障自己的资产安全,享受去中心化金融带来的便利。
在日常交易中,用户需要保持警惕,了解怎样识别合法地址,防范潜在的风险。通过常识和技能的提升,不仅能够保护个人财产安全,还能为整个以太坊社区的发展作出贡献。